Středeční postřeh: Visual Basic for Applications je hybrid
Microsoft je zřejmě drsňák, který se nebojí kombinovat různé programátorské přístupy. Následující kousek zdrojáku má v sobě vše: číslované řádky ala 80. léta (všimněte si krásného GoSub), strukturované programování ala 90. léta (je to ostatně procedura) i objekty ala moderna:
Public Sub YeOldeSchool() 10 Debug.Print "Zacatek programu." 20 GoSub 50 30 Debug.Print "Zpet ze subrutiny." 40 Stop 50 Rem tady zacina subrutina 60 Debug.Print "Prichazi subrutina." 70 Return End SubKód je naprosto funkční, alespoň v MS Office 2003, které používáme v práci. Ještě jednou, bravo Microsofte!
Komentáře
[1] (F6 ) Vloženo 28.01.2009, 14:54:22
Neni nad Sinclair BASIC, nebo skvely Super BASIC na QL. Tak me napadlo, sranda by byla, kdyby M$ aplikoval paskvil typu BASIC V2 z Commodore, pak by se vse krome PRINTu muselo delat prikazy POKE :)[2]OPL (Logout - Mail - WWW) Vloženo 28.01.2009, 15:03:45
Opravdu je v tom radost psat, jen je skoda, ze Nokia uz v novych Symbianech s OPL nepocita, posledni je na komunikatoru N9500.
[3]Commodore Basic as scripting language (dex - WWW) Vloženo 28.01.2009, 15:07:06
Taková věc opravdu existuje.
http://www.pagetable.com/?p=48
Na stránce je možné nalézt i odkaz na Apple 1 integer basic :o)
[4]to dex (F6 ) Vloženo 28.01.2009, 16:10:23
to znam, myslel jsem to z legrace, kdyby m$ degradoval svoje visualni prostredi na zapis poke adresa,hodnota :)Všechna pole jsou nepovinná.
Vaše IP adresa nebude veřejně zobrazena.
Číslo v hranatých závorkách vytvoří odkaz na daný komentář.
Avatar friendly.
Vaše IP adresa nebude veřejně zobrazena.
Číslo v hranatých závorkách vytvoří odkaz na daný komentář.
Avatar friendly.


